Rosariense Clube da Ribeira Grande, also as Rosariense Desportivo Clube, short or conventional form: Rosariense Clube (Capeverdean Crioulo, ALUPEC or ALUPEK: Rozariensi Klubi and the São Vicente Crioulo: Rosariense Klube) is a football club that had played in the Premier division and plays in the Santo Antão Island League South Zone in Cape Verde. It is based in the town of Ribeira Grande in the northeastern part of the island of Santo Antão. Its current chairman is Orlando de Jesus Delgado who is since September 12, 2015
Rosariense is the third most successful football (soccer) club in the North Zone having won about 5 official regional titles, overall it is fourth with the South Zone's Sporting Porto Novo with 8 official regional and subregional titles combined.
